What is the shape of the wavefront in the following case?

The portion of the wavefront of light from a distant star was intercepted by the Earth.

आकृति
एक पंक्ति में उत्तर
Advertisements

उत्तर

The portion of the wavefront of the light from a distant star intercepted by the Earth is a plane.
